php
html 调用 php 函数
一、html 调用 php 函数
使用HTML调用PHP函数的方法
在网页开发中,利用HTML调用PHP函数是一种常见的技术。PHP作为一种服务器端脚本语言,可以与HTML结合使用,实现动态网页的功能。本文将介绍如何在HTML中调用PHP函数,以及一些实用的技巧和注意事项。
基本方法
要在HTML中调用PHP函数,首先需要确保你的网站支持PHP并已正确配置。在HTML文件中,你可以使用PHP的内嵌语法,通过在代码中插入PHP代码块来调用函数。例如,使用以下代码来调用一个名为example_function
的PHP函数:
<?php
example_function();
?>
注意事项
在使用HTML调用PHP函数时,需要注意以下几点:
- 确保PHP函数已经定义并可被调用。
- 注意PHP函数的传参方式,确保参数的正确传递。
- 在调用PHP函数时,要注意PHP代码块的定位和格式,确保代码的可读性和调试的便利性。
示例
接下来,我们通过一个示例来演示如何在HTML中调用一个简单的PHP函数。假设我们有一个PHP文件functions.php
,其中定义了以下函数:
<?php
function greet() {
echo "你好,世界!";
}
?>
现在,在我们的HTML文件中,可以通过以下方式调用这个函数:
<?php
include 'functions.php';
greet();
?>
运行这段代码后,页面上将显示:你好,世界!
结论
使用HTML调用PHP函数是一种强大的技术,可以为网页添加更多动态和交互性。了解如何正确地在HTML中调用PHP函数,可以让你更好地利用这一技术。希望本文对你有所帮助!
二、php函数插入html
PHP函数插入:优化网页内容的必备技巧
在网页开发过程中,PHP函数的运用不仅可以实现动态内容的显示和数据处理,还可以简化代码结构,提高开发效率。其中,插入HTML内容是常见且必不可少的操作之一。本文将深入探讨如何利用PHP函数来插入HTML,以优化网页内容,提升用户体验。
PHP函数简介
PHP作为一种服务器端脚本语言,提供了丰富的函数库和工具,用于处理网页内容、数据库操作、文件系统管理等各种任务。PHP函数的使用可以极大地简化代码编写,并实现复杂功能的快速实现。在网页开发中,PHP函数通常用于动态生成HTML内容,使网页内容更具交互性和实用性。
插入HTML内容
插入HTML内容是网页开发中常见的操作,可以实现动态显示数据、创建交互式页面等功能。在PHP中,可以通过echo语句将HTML代码直接输出到页面上,也可以通过PHP函数动态生成HTML内容并插入到指定位置。这种灵活的方式使得网页内容可以根据用户的需求和操作动态更新,为用户提供更好的浏览体验。
利用PHP函数插入HTML的几种常用方法
- 1. 使用echo语句插入HTML内容
- 2. 利用PHP函数生成HTML代码并输出
- 3. 在指定位置插入动态生成的HTML内容
示例:利用PHP函数动态生成HTML内容
下面是一个简单的示例,演示如何利用PHP函数动态生成HTML内容,并将其插入到指定位置:
".$content."
在上面的示例中,generateHTML函数用于生成一个包含特定内容的HTML块,然后通过echo语句将其输出到页面上。这种方法可以方便地创建各种动态内容,实现网页内容的灵活展示。
应用场景
利用PHP函数插入HTML可以应用于各种场景,比如:
- 1. 动态显示用户信息、最新文章等内容
- 2. 根据用户权限生成不同的页面布局
- 3. 实现交互式表单、动态加载等功能
总结
PHP函数的灵活运用可以为网页开发工作带来便利和效率提升。通过插入HTML内容,可以实现更加动态、交互式的网页显示效果,从而提高用户体验和网站功能的吸引力。在开发过程中,合理运用PHP函数来插入HTML内容将成为开发人员的重要技能之一。
希望本文能够帮助您更好地理解如何利用PHP函数插入HTML内容,优化网页开发工作。祝您在网页开发中取得更大的成功!
三、php 输入过滤 函数
在编写 PHP 代码时,输入过滤函数是非常重要的一部分,可以帮助确保输入数据的安全性和可靠性。PHP 输入过滤函数是专门用来处理和过滤用户输入数据的函数,以防止恶意代码注入、SQL 注入以及其他安全漏洞。在本文中,我们将探讨一些常用的 PHP 输入过滤函数,以及它们的用法和作用。
什么是 PHP 输入过滤函数?
PHP 输入过滤函数是一组能够对用户输入数据进行过滤和处理的函数,在数据传输到后端处理之前,可以帮助清洗数据、去除潜在的危险字符,并确保数据符合预期格式和类型的函数。通过使用这些函数,可以有效地防止恶意用户输入造成的安全漏洞。
常用的 PHP 输入过滤函数
以下是一些常用的 PHP 输入过滤函数,可以在项目中广泛应用:
- filter_var() - 这是一个十分强大且灵活的函数,可以用来过滤多种类型的数据,如 URL、邮箱、整数等。
- htmlspecialchars() - 用于将特殊字符转换为 实体,以防止 XSS 攻击。
- mysqli_real_escape_string() - 专门用于处理数据库相关的输入,可以防止 SQL 注入攻击。
- intval() - 将变量转换为整数类型,在处理纯数字输入时非常有用。
如何正确使用 PHP 输入过滤函数?
正确使用 PHP 输入过滤函数是确保代码安全性的关键。以下是一些建议和最佳实践:
- 始终对所有用户输入的数据进行过滤和处理,无论用户角色或权限如何。
- 在接收数据后第一时间应用过滤函数,确保没有未经处理的数据混入系统。
- 根据不同的输入类型选择合适的过滤函数,例如 URL、整数、邮箱等。
- 避免直接使用用户输入数据拼接 SQL 查询语句,应该使用数据库相关的过滤函数来处理。
总结
PHP 输入过滤函数在保障应用程序安全性方面起着至关重要的作用。通过合理和正确地使用这些函数,可以有效地防止常见的安全漏洞,并提升系统的稳定性和可靠性。务必在所有项目中养成使用输入过滤函数的良好习惯,一点一滴地加固系统的安全防线。
四、php 函数过滤
PHP函数过滤在Web开发中起着至关重要的作用,它帮助开发人员确保输入数据的可靠性和安全性,防止恶意代码注入和其他安全风险,保护用户数据不受损害。本文将探讨在PHP中如何有效地进行函数过滤,以确保应用程序的健壮性和可靠性。
PHP函数过滤方法
PHP提供了各种函数过滤方法,其中包括输出过滤函数、输入过滤函数和数据验证函数。以下是一些常用的PHP函数过滤方法:
- htmlspecialchars: 用于对特殊字符进行转义,防止XSS攻击。
- strip_tags: 用于过滤字符串中的HTML和PHP标签。
- filter_var: 用于过滤和验证数据,支持多种过滤器类型。
PHP函数过滤的重要性
任何一个Web应用程序都可能受到恶意攻击,尤其是通过输入表单提交恶意代码的方式。通过对输入数据进行函数过滤,可以减少这种风险,保护应用程序不受损害。
合适的函数过滤方法可以有效地防止SQL注入、XSS攻击和其他常见的安全漏洞。通过合理使用PHP函数过滤,开发人员可以提高应用程序的安全性,并为用户数据安全提供保障。
PHP函数过滤的最佳实践
要确保PHP函数过滤的有效性,开发人员应遵循以下最佳实践:
- 输入验证: 在接受用户输入之前,应对数据进行验证,确保数据符合预期格式和要求。
- 输出过滤: 在输出数据到客户端时,应使用适当的函数过滤方法,确保数据安全可靠。
- 避免直接拼接: 尽量避免直接拼接用户输入数据,而是使用函数过滤方法处理数据。
- 定期更新过滤规则: 定期检查和更新过滤规则,以保持应用程序的安全性。
结论
在PHP开发中,正确使用函数过滤是确保应用程序安全的关键措施。通过了解PHP函数过滤的重要性和最佳实践,开发人员可以提高应用程序的安全性,防止恶意攻击,保护用户数据不受损害。希望本文能够帮助您更好地理解PHP函数过滤的重要性和方法,提升您的Web开发技能。
五、html和php的区别?
HTML是超文本标记语言;PHP 独特的语法混合了 C、Java、Perl 以及 PHP 自创新的语法。
HTML主要用在客户端的显示,比如我们浏览的网页,特别是静态网页,都是用html语言写的,在网页上点击右键,查看源文件,就可以看到html代码了。
PHP是服务器的语言,主要用来对处理客户通过网页提交的信息,它是运行在服务器端的,用来响应客户的请求。它可以比 CGI或者Perl更快速的执行动态网页。用PHP做出的动态页面与其他的编程语言相比;
PHP是将程序嵌入到HTML文档中去执行,执行效率比完全生成HTML标记的CGI要高许多;PHP还可以执行编译后代码,编译可以达到加密和优化代码运行,使代码运行更快。PHP具有非常强大的功能,所有的CGI的功能PHP都能实现,而且支持几乎所有流行的数据库以及操作系统。
六、HTML属于web,PHP呢?
html属于web前端页面的开发,而php是属于后端的程序开发。 后端和前端是有关联性的,如果你要学习你只需要掌握web前端的开发技术就可以了。或者你直接只学习php开发程序就可以,因为在很多公司的分分工是很明确的,所以做好自己的工作即可。 但是如果你要创业或者自己做项目,可以全方位学习下也可以的!
七、PHP中如何使用过滤HTML内容
为什么需要在PHP中过滤HTML内容?
在网站开发中,用户输入的内容可能包含恶意代码,如JavaScript,以及其他有害的标记。为了防止这些恶意内容对网站产生危害,我们需要在PHP中对HTML内容进行过滤。
使用htmlspecialchars函数过滤HTML内容
在PHP中,可以使用htmlspecialchars
函数对HTML内容进行过滤,该函数会将特殊字符转换为HTML实体,从而避免代码注入的风险。例如:
$text = "这是一段包含HTML标记的内容
";
echo htmlspecialchars($text);
使用strip_tags函数过滤HTML内容
另一个常用的过滤HTML内容的函数是strip_tags
,该函数用于从字符串中去除HTML和PHP标记。例如:
$text = "这是一段包含HTML标记的内容
";
echo strip_tags($text);
过滤HTML内容的注意事项
在使用函数过滤HTML内容时,需要注意保留必要的HTML标记,避免影响页面的显示效果。同时,针对不同的输入内容,选择合适的过滤函数和参数也是非常重要的。
结语
在PHP中过滤HTML内容是保护网站安全的重要一环。通过本文的介绍,相信你对如何在PHP中过滤HTML内容有了更清晰的认识。
感谢阅读!希望本文能帮助你更好地理解在PHP中如何过滤HTML内容。
八、PHP中怎么打html框架?
使用php的include()函数将外部的HTML文件连接到PHP文件中
九、php和html怎么结合的?
首先需要安装一个web服务器,然后安装PHP语言,设置web部服务器支持PHP语言。
你可以在PHP网页文件中插入PHP语言的内容和HTML语句的内容。PHP语句块使用<?php开始,用?>结束。
或者也可以在PHP语句中把HTML内容当做字符串来输出。这样在浏览器打开的时候,看到的就是纯HTML内容。
十、php关于intval函数?
intval函数:变量转成整数类型; 函数语法: int intval(mixed var, int [base]); 函数返回值: 整数; 函数种类: PHP 系统功能; 函数内容:本函数可将变量转成整数类型。可省略的参数 base 是转换的基底,默认值为 10。转换的变量 var 可以为数组或类之外的任何类型变量。